abstract 1,258,129. Titanium dioxide pigments. E.I. DU PONT DE NEMOURS & CO. 2 April, 1969 [5 April, 1968], No. 17194/69. Heading C1N. TiO 2 pigment is coated, by (a) adding an aqueous silicate solution to an acid agitated aqueous slurry of TiO 2 pigment so that 3-10% of silica (calc. as SiO 2 , based on wt. of TiO 2 ) is precipitated, the pH on completion of the addition being not more than 7; and then (b) adding a source of alumina to the agitated slurry maintained at pH 6-8 so that 1-10% of alumina is precipitated (calc. as Al 2 O 3 , based on wt. of TiO 2 ). The TiO 2 pigment may be anatase or nitrile, particle size 0À15-0À3 micron. Silica precipitation may be effected either by neutralizing, by addition of silicate solution, an aqueous TiO 2 slurry initially acidified by an amount of acid in excess of, or stoichiometrically equivalent to the "alkali" content of the silicate, or by simultaneously adding silicate and acid to the slurry at constant pH level, e.g. 1. Specified acids are H 2 SO 4 , HCl, H 3 PO 4 and hydrolysable compounds such as TiOSO 4 and TiCl 4 . Alumina precipitation may be carried out by simultaneously mixing, with the slurry, acid and alkaline solutions, one of which contains an A1 salt. Specified pairs of reagents are NaOH and Al 2 (SO 4 ) 3 , NaAlO 2 and H 2 SO 4 , NaAlO 2 and alum. The process is. applicable to TiO 2 derived from gas phase oxidation or hydrolysis of TiCl 4 , or hydrolysis of a seeded H 2 SO 4 solution of a titaniferous ore. The TiO 2 may have been calcined in the presence of, or treated with other oxides. In one example, the product also contains hydrated TiO 2 , derived from the TiCl 4 used to acidify the initial TiO 2 slurry.
